Empire Strikes Back and Wrath of Khan.

The two movies that are generally accepted as each franchise's best.

 

Choose the one you prefer.

 

 

Some stats...

 

Empire Strikes Back

- released May 1980

- budget $18-33 million

- box office $534-538 million

 

Wrath of Khan

- released June 1982

- budget $11.2 million

- box office $97 million

I love both franchises, but this is no contest. Empire Strikes Back is easily the best film in the Star Trek/Star Wars universes. The challenger for me from the Star Trek side would be Star Trek: First Contact, but I'm also a much bigger fan of TNG & DS9 than the original series cast. I voted other in the favourite character poll because I feel like this is Leia's best film. We get to see her at her sardonic best, especially when rebuffing Han, but we also see her fall in love in the process and deal with real hardships in an awesomely thoughtful and caring way. My second favourite character in these films is also not on the list. I would go with C3PO, because not only is he the best cock-blocker in space, but he is also at his comedic best as he suffers constant ignominy. Yoda finishes a close 3rd.
